Revolutionizing Cooking: India's Transition to Clean Energy

Global uncertainties affecting energy supplies have reverberated in India, raising concerns about escalating cylinder costs and the reliability of fossil fuels for essential needs like cooking. The challenges are particularly amplified for establishments operating large-scale kitchens, hostels, and communal cooking spaces.

A Green Revolution in Cooking

Greenvize (GreenVize SPC Techno Pvt. Ltd.), a Haryana-based startup, has emerged as a game-changer in the clean cooking landscape. Their innovative hydrogen cooking system signifies a shift towards sustainable energy solutions with the potential to replace traditional LPG cylinders.

Founded in 2024 by Sanjeev Choudhary, Greenvize is at the forefront of aligning with India's National Green Hydrogen Mission. In addition to the revolutionary cooking solution, the company is delving into various technologies such as fuel cells, biomass power, carbon capture, and wastewater treatment, positioning itself as a holistic sustainability leader.

The Breakthrough Hydrogen Stove

Greenvize's hydrogen stove appears akin to a regular gas stove but operates entirely on green hydrogen. Featuring a dual-burner setup and robust stainless steel construction, this stove boasts self-sufficiency by generating its fuel sans the need for external storage or pipelines.

  • No bulky cylinders or fuel storage requirements
  • Operates on water and electricity, ensuring efficiency
  • Compatible with standard cookware, guaranteeing user convenience

Green Innovation at Work

The heart of the system lies in its integrated Proton Exchange Membrane (PEM) electrolyser, splitting water into hydrogen and oxygen on demand. By eliminating the need for bulk hydrogen storage, this stove streamlines the cooking process, prioritizing sustainability and emission reduction.

Unlike LPG combustion that contributes to carbon emissions, hydrogen combustion is clean, emitting only water vapor. This environmental benefit enhances the stove's appeal to institutions aiming to reduce their carbon footprint while maintaining cooking efficiency.

Practicality and Long-Term Viability

The hydrogen stove targets establishments requiring continuous cooking operations, offering uninterrupted fuel supply without the constraints of LPG refills. Despite being a pricier investment initially, costing around Rs 1.5 lakh per unit, potential cost reductions in hydrogen production could offset this expense over time.

Factors such as reliable electricity access, installation space, and maintenance requirements will influence the stove's adoption rate, shaping its feasibility in diverse operational settings.

The Future of Clean Cooking

Greenvize's hydrogen stove embodies a shift towards sustainable cooking practices, reflecting India's pursuit of environmental integrity and energy independence. While not an immediate substitute for LPG, this innovation sets a benchmark for future cooking technologies, emphasizing both ecological impact and operational efficiency.

The stove's ability to compete with LPG hinges on evolving cost dynamics, infrastructural readiness, and the progression of India's green hydrogen ecosystem. It poses a compelling alternative in the quest for cleaner, reliable cooking solutions, propelling hydrogen as a pivotal player in the culinary landscape.
